Keep your computer physically clean, close all unnecessary applications while playing, uninstall all apps/games you aren't using, use lowest settings, overclock CPU/GPU/RAM if possible, keep drivers up-to-date

As one that built a decent system on mostly used parts alone, I can say you don’t have to avoid it. Just be sure to inspect the hell out of it and if possible, see it operating. Also, never pay much for used parts if you can’t see them operable.
